What Are Organic Kelp Strips?
Organic kelp strips are thin, dried pieces of kelp, which is a type of brown seaweed. Renowned for their umami flavor, these strips are rich in vitamins and minerals, including iodine, calcium, and iron. Typically sourced from clean, sustainable waters, organic kelp is harvested without the use of harmful chemicals, ensuring a pure and nutritious product.
The Different Varieties of Kelp
There are several types of kelp, including kombu, wakame, and nori. Each variety has its own distinct taste and culinary application. Kombu, often used in Japanese cooking, is particularly favored for making broths and soups. Understanding the differences between these varieties can help you choose the right kelp strips for your needs.
Nutritional Benefits of Organic Kelp Strips
Incorporating organic kelp strips into your diet offers a wide range of health benefits. Here’s a closer look at some of the key nutritional advantages:
Rich in Iodine
Iodine is essential for thyroid function, which regulates metabolism. Organic kelp strips are one of the richest dietary sources of iodine, making them a valuable addition for those looking to support their thyroid health.
Packed with Vitamins and Minerals
Organic kelp strips are loaded with vitamins A, C, E, and K, as well as minerals like calcium, magnesium, and potassium. These nutrients contribute to overall health, from maintaining strong bones to supporting immune function.
High in Antioxidants
Kelp is known for its antioxidant properties, which help protect the body from oxidative stress and inflammation. Regular consumption of organic kelp strips can contribute to better overall health and wellness.
Culinary Uses of Organic Kelp Strips
Organic kelp strips are incredibly versatile and can be utilized in various culinary applications. Here are some popular ways to incorporate them into your meals:
Soups and Broths
Kelp strips can be used to create a flavorful base for soups and broths. Simply add a strip to boiling water, and let it simmer to extract its rich umami flavor.
Salads and Wraps
Chop organic kelp strips and toss them into salads for an added crunch and nutritional boost. They work wonderfully in wraps, providing texture and flavor.
Sushi and Rice Dishes
Kelp strips are often used in sushi rolls, either as a wrap or as a filling. They can also enhance rice dishes, adding depth and a unique flavor profile.

Storage Tips for Organic Kelp Strips
Proper storage is key to maintaining the freshness and flavor of organic kelp strips. Here are some effective storage tips:
Keep in a Cool, Dry Place
Store kelp strips in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. A pantry or cupboard works well.
Use Airtight Containers
Transfer kelp strips to airtight containers to keep them fresh and prevent moisture absorption.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Are organic kelp strips gluten-free?
Yes, organic kelp strips are naturally gluten-free, making them suitable for those with gluten sensitivities or celiac disease.
2. Can I eat kelp strips raw?
Yes, you can enjoy kelp strips raw in salads or as a snack. They can also be rehydrated in water for use in various dishes.
3. How much iodine is in organic kelp strips?
The iodine content can vary depending on the type of kelp and where it’s harvested. On average, kelp strips contain about 2000% of the daily recommended intake per serving.
4. Are there any side effects of consuming too much kelp?
While kelp is healthy, excessive consumption can lead to iodine toxicity. It’s essential to consume kelp in moderation.
5. How can I prepare kelp strips for cooking?
To prepare kelp strips, simply rinse them in cold water to remove any salt or impurities, then soak in warm water if you want to soften them before adding them to your dishes.
